The PDR is published on CD-ROM.  Unfortunately, it is easily accessed
only under DOS, and only through the proprietary DOS program which
provides the user interface to the database.  The CD-ROM itself is an
ISO9660 filesystem, but it contains a single monolithic file which is
a jumble of binary bookkeeping data and the PDR text.  I don't know if
you can get the data on the exact format of this database file.

I have it mounted on my Sun workstation and it's quite unrewarding trying to
use EMACS to search for drug entries. :-)

The PDR is also available on tape designed to be read by a database
program.  We've put it online at Beth Israel hospital in Boston.
I can supply further information about this if anyone is interested.
I have no connection with Medical Economics other than using their
tapes.
